TICKET CV-418: Catalog cache invalidation broke after the Quillhaven vault auto-locked mid-rotation. Stale SKUs in the Fernmart product catalog persisted for 40 minutes; purge jobs couldn't fetch signing material. Root cause: TTL refresh raced the lock daemon. Fix deployed; vault must be reopened to resume invalidation hooks. Security review needed on the unlock path. The recovery passphrase for the vault follows below.

vault phrase of tajop-haduf = holath-brivan-wenax

The proposed plan adds 34 roles across Veldane Systems, weighted toward the Corsa platform engineering group and the Tillbrook support center. Attrition modeling assumes 9% voluntary turnover, consistent with the past two years. Contractor conversion accounts for 11 of the new positions, reducing agency spend meaningfully. Regional salary benchmarks have been refreshed for the Ostlin market. One assumption underpinning the second-half hiring wave is tied to a sensitive matter noted below.

internal memo for tafog-kageg: Headcount on the Tamion team goes from 9 to 94 by the end of May. Gross margin on Tamion came in at 23 percent against a plan of 58 percent.

Wikfern 3.x replaces per-page ACLs with role bindings. Plugin authors: the legacy `canEdit` hook is gone. Declare required roles in your plugin manifest instead; the core resolves them at render time. Unmapped legacy permissions are dropped silently, so run the audit command before upgrading. Plugins that mint their own roles must register them during install, not at runtime, or binding resolution fails. Custom role inheritance is disabled by default. The migration tool expects the following access-control settings in your instance config.

settings of yaguf-bahip:
druwyn:
  log_level: debug
  metrics_host: metrics.druwyn.qorvelsys.internal
  pool_size: 32

## Deployment

Heads up, plugin authors: Coinfold does all currency math in integer micro-units to dodge rounding drift, and your plugin should too. If you hand us floats, the converter will round half-even and you may see off-by-one discrepancies in reconciliation reports. Deploy against the staging converter first and compare totals. The staging deployment ships with the following configuration values.

settings of baweg-tadup:
[julwyn]
host = julwyn.novacdata.internal
user = julwyn_svc
database = julwyn_prod